What is the maximum number of clubs allowed in a golf bag according to the USGA?

  1. 12

  2. 14

  3. 16

  4. 18


Correct Option: B
Explanation:

According to the USGA, a golfer is allowed to carry a maximum of 14 clubs in their golf bag during a round of golf.

Which type of golf club is typically used for long-distance shots?

  1. Driver

  2. Putter

  3. Wedge

  4. Iron


Correct Option: A
Explanation:

A driver is a type of golf club specifically designed for long-distance shots. It has a large clubhead and a long shaft, allowing golfers to generate more clubhead speed and distance.

Which golf accessory is used to repair divots on the green?

  1. Ball marker

  2. Divot tool

  3. Sand wedge

  4. Golf glove


Correct Option: B
Explanation:

A divot tool is a golf accessory specifically designed to repair divots on the green. It is used to carefully replace the turf that has been displaced by a golf shot, helping to maintain the quality of the playing surface.

Which golf accessory is used to measure the distance to the hole?

  1. Rangefinder

  2. GPS watch

  3. Yardage book

  4. Laser level


Correct Option: A
Explanation:

A rangefinder is a golf accessory used to measure the distance to the hole. It emits a laser beam that bounces off the target and returns to the device, providing an accurate measurement of the distance.
